Output e4dfd75db410870067cfd18b18a781702f900dc9af8d9d685933af126f6b6ddc:3

value
1529752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d64c91e8eb2562b78ca3a008ead31b169123233 OP_EQUAL
address
3JxSNWPZBeyfS16aaKn6mWZ3bxPd9Cj47h
transaction
e4dfd75db410870067cfd18b18a781702f900dc9af8d9d685933af126f6b6ddc
spent
true